WHO IS IT FOR?
This kit is designed for professional photographers, videographers, content creators, commercial shooters and advanced enthusiasts. It is especially suitable for architecture, interiors, landscapes, travel, weddings, events, documentary work, real estate photography and commercial content. The 16–35 mm focal range gives a wide field of view, while the constant F2.8 aperture is useful in lower light and for consistent exposure while zooming.

AUTOFOCUS AND SPEED
The Sony A7R VI features advanced autofocus with Real-time Recognition AF+ and AI-based subject recognition. It can track people, animals, vehicles and other subjects accurately even when they move. The FE 16-35mm F2.8 GM II uses four XD Linear Motors, delivering fast, precise and quiet autofocus for both stills and video.

WHAT SHOULD YOU CONSIDER?
The Sony A7R VI creates large files, so fast memory cards, enough storage and a capable editing computer are recommended. The 16-35mm F2.8 GM II is a professional wide-angle lens, so this kit is best suited for serious photography and video work rather than casual everyday use only. Also, 16–35 mm is not intended for distant subjects — it is designed for wide-angle scenes, spaces and dynamic storytelling.
COMPARISON WITH ALTERNATIVES
Compared with a kit using a simpler all-purpose lens, the Sony A7R VI + 16-35mm F2.8 GM II offers stronger wide-angle optical quality and a constant F2.8 aperture. Compared with a 24–70 mm kit, this set is better suited for interiors, architecture, landscapes and situations where a wider view is needed. Compared with the previous 16-35mm F2.8 GM, the GM II version is lighter, more compact and better suited to modern hybrid photo and video work.

Does the lens have optical stabilisation?
No, the lens does not have optical stabilisation, but the Sony A7R VI has in-body image stabilisation.

Is 16–35 mm enough for portraits?
It works well for environmental portraits, but classic close portraits are usually easier with 50 mm, 85 mm or 24–70 mm lenses.
SPECIFICATIONS
Kit: Sony A7R VI + Sony FE 16-35mm F2.8 GM II
Camera type: Full-frame mirrorless camera
Camera model: Sony A7R VI
Lens model: Sony FE 16-35mm F2.8 GM II
Camera mount: Sony E-mount
Lens mount: Sony E-mount
Sensor: 35 mm full-frame Exmor RS CMOS
Sensor size: 35.9 x 24.0 mm
Effective resolution for stills: approx. 66.8 MP
Effective resolution for movies: approx. 55.8 MP
Processor: BIONZ XR2 with integrated AI processing
Autofocus: Phase-detection AF, Real-time Recognition AF+
AF points: up to 759 points
Continuous shooting: up to 30 fps with AF/AE tracking
ISO sensitivity: ISO 100–32000, expandable to ISO 50–102400
Image stabilisation: in-body
Video: 8K up to 30p, 4K up to 120p
Video format: MPEG-4 AVC/H.264, MPEG-H HEVC/H.265
Memory media: CFexpress Type A, SD / SDHC / SDXC
Monitor: 3.2-type TFT LCD, touch panel
Viewfinder resolution: 9,437,184 dots
Battery: NP-SA100
Camera weight with battery and card: approx. 713 g
Camera dimensions: approx. 132.7 x 96.9 x 82.9 mm
Lens type: full-frame wide-angle zoom lens
Lens series: Sony G Master
Focal length: 16–35 mm
APS-C equivalent focal length: 24–52.5 mm
Maximum aperture: F2.8
Minimum aperture: F22
Optical construction: 15 elements in 12 groups
Aperture blades: 11
Minimum focus distance: 0.22 m
Maximum magnification: 0.32x
Filter diameter: 82 mm
Lens stabilisation: no, uses in-body stabilisation
Lens dimensions: approx. 87.8 x 111.5 mm
Lens weight: approx. 547 g
In the box: Sony A7R VI body, Sony FE 16-35mm F2.8 GM II lens, battery, charger, strap, body cap, lens caps, lens hood, soft case

2. What are the advantages of mirrorless cameras compared to DSLR cameras?
The advantages of mirrorless cameras over DSLR cameras include modern technology and lightness. Mirrorless cameras are more compact and lighter, making them more comfortable to carry. They often have a smaller body because they do not have a mirror system, which reduces the overall weight. The use of an electronic viewfinder allows the actual frame to be seen before the picture is taken, thus optimising composition and exposure. Mirrorless cameras have fast autofocus and some models may perform better in low light conditions. They also offer more creative options, including a range of filters and effects. The new generation of lenses offers improved performance and efficiency, contributing to higher quality photos.
